Block

#21,764,846
Block Number
21,764,846 @ 05/25/2025, 12:54:30
Status
Finalized
ID
0x014c1aee715cce24998e3ad3989bf72310e89e083d455c7a86feb38d5dcfabbd
Transactions
Gas Used
7238432/40000000 (18.10% Used)
Total Score
2,125,616,676 (+98)
Rewards
30.55 VTHO